企业架构

企业架构(英语:Enterprise ArchitectureEA,或企业体系结构)是在信息系统架构设计与实施的实践基础上发展起来的一个特殊领域,现有的实践,主要来自大型组织,例如政府建设。自1987年Zachman的开创性工作[1]以来,这个领域累积了不少研究与实践,但对“企业架构”概念还没有出现一致公认的定义[2],综合现有的研究与实践,可以从下面几个方面理解:

企业架构的产生与发展

 
企业架构框架的演化(点击查看原图)

Zachman框架

企业架构方面的研究与实践源自1980年代关信息系统的规划与设计领域。John Zachman(1987)[1]提出了“信息系统架构的框架”(Framework for Information Systems Architecture),它是一个通用的组织架构模型分类方案,为现今所称的企业架构提出了一个基本的概要性视图。这一工作被视为企业架构方面的开创性工作之一[2]。 在Zachman (1987)基础上,Zhchman以及John Sowa,Keri Anderson,Clive Finkelstein等合作或分别进行了扩充或改进。Zachman (1997)[3]总结提出了经过扩充的、更完整的框架,并改称为“企业架构框架”(Framework for Enterprise Architecture)。

早期应用和发展[4]

1996年美国的Clinger-Cohen 法案(曾被称作信息技术管理改革法案)导致了术语“IT架构”的产生。Clinger-Cohen法案要求政府机构的CIO要负责开发、维护和帮助一个合理的和集成的IT架构(ITA)的实施,当时的术语ITA,现在被解释为IT企业架构(EA)。因此,企业架构的早期应用是在一些美国的政府机构,美国政府对企业架构发展起了重要的推动作用。

在Zachman框架的基础上,美国联邦政府内不同部门曾先后提出、应用过多个框架。1999年9月,美国联邦CIO委员会发布了联邦企业架构框架(FEAF)。FEAF旨在为联邦机构提供一个架构的公共结构,以利于这些联邦机构间的公共业务流程、技术引入、信息流和系统投资的协调等。FEAF定义了一个IT企业架构作为战略信息资产库,它定义了业务、运作业务所必须的业务信息,支持业务运行的必要的IT技术,响应业务变革实施新技术所必须的变革流程等要素。2002年2月,OMB建立联邦企业架构程序管理办公室,开发了联邦企业架构(Federal Enterprise Architecture,FEA)。

美国标准研究院企业参考模型(NIST EA Model)

美国标准研究院(NIST)在1989年发表的研究报告[5]中,提出了NIST企业架构模型(NIST Enterprise Architecture Model),它是一个五层模型,是后来的重要企业框架FEAF的主要基础之一。

美国政府联邦企业架构框架(FEAF)

美国联邦CIO委员会1999年发布的“联邦企业架构框架”(Federal Enterprise Architecture Framework,FEAF)[6],是在美国标准研究院企业参考框架(NIST EA Model)和Zachman等商业领域的研究工作基础上提出的。由业务、数据、应用、绩效和技术5个参考模型构成。

美国国防部信息管理技术架构框架(TAFIM)

另一项早期工作是美国国防部开发的一个企业架构参考模型,称为“信息管理技术架构框架”(Technical Architecture Framework for Information Management, TAFIM),其最初的草案TAFIM技术参考模型(TAFIM TRM)于1991年提出。[7]

Open Group的架构框架(TOGAF)

目前在商业企业领域较有影响的企业架构框架之一,是信息技术标准化组织Open Group的架构框架(TOGAF),其最初的版本(1995)是在TAFIM基础上完成的。这一企业架构框架标准一直在改进之中,目前已发行了第10版[8]

参考条目

本条目内容参考了以下英文维基上的条目:

参考资料

  1. ^ 1.0 1.1 John A. Zachman (1987). A Framework for Information Systems Architecture页面存档备份,存于互联网档案馆. IBM Systems Journal, vol 26, no 3
  2. ^ 2.0 2.1 Special Issue Enterprise Architecture - A 20 Year Retrospective. Perspectives of the IASA, April 2007
  3. ^ John A. Zachman (1997). Concepts of the Framework for Enterprise Architecture: Background, Description and Utility页面存档备份,存于互联网档案馆. Zachman International. Accessed 19 Jan 2009.
  4. ^ 赵刚(2006). 企业架构的发展历史与概念.赛迪网,2006年3月
  5. ^ Elizabeth N. Fong and Alan H. Goldfine (1989). Information Management Directions: The Integration Challenge. NIST Special Publication 500-167, September 1989.
  6. ^ The Chief Information Officers Council (1999). Federal Enterprise Architecture Framework Version 1.1页面存档备份,存于互联网档案馆). September 1999.
  7. ^ Department of Defense (1996). Technical Architecture Framework for Information Management. Vol. 1. April 1996
  8. ^ An Introduction to the TOGAF® Standard, 10th Edition. [2022-09-14]. (原始内容存档于2023-01-27).